Charlene Ferry

I started working for John McGee at Top Drawer Salon in 1989, when he retired in 2000 I had the opportunity to purchase his salon.
For the next several years I revamped the look to create a bohemian, eclectic vibe where anyone would feel welcome and comfortable.  I have since changed the name to Salon Indah to make it my own.

I enjoy the creative challenges and value the diversity that each client’s bring to my salon.  In this ever changing industry there are always opportunities to grow and refine my skills.  I trained at Abba Academy for hair cutting and am certified with Organic Salon Services and Brazilian Blowout.  I stay current with trends by continually taking classes for cuts, color, style and products.  I believe in preventive health and natural products which is why I have incorporated them in my salon for the wellbeing of our environment, stylists and clients.

I have a passion for animals, nature, organic gardening and paddle boarding making Belmont Shore the ideal location to work. I love all music, but most of all roots and blues.  I visit New Orleans and Austin whenever possible for my music fix. My personal interest and hobbies are reflected in the salon to create a unique styling experience for both my employees and customers.

I believe in keeping hair healthy; I love to help clients grow their hair longer especially when they say “it just doesn’t grow past my shoulders”.

Ilana Tracy

I started my hair journey in 1987 and quickly fell in love with making people feel beautiful about themselves, inside and out. I soon became an assistant at the elite San Francisco salon, 77 Maiden Lane. 

I went on to work in several different states, furthering my knowledge and expertise by becoming a Redken Master Specialist, taking workshops with famed colorist Beth Minardi, and getting certified in Brazilian Blowouts and Keratin Hair Extensions. I was part of Redken Symposium in New York and Las Vegas, and Sebastian Global Exchange in Puerto Rico.

In 2000, I relocated to Long Beach, with its unique vibe and diverse communities, and worked at Anthony’s Studio 7. I’ve always loved the charm of Belmont Shore, so in 2013, I walked into Studio Indah and felt welcomed immediately, with an offer of tea and conversation. I Ioved its relaxed and nurturing feel, and knew my clients would to. I’ve been here, working with this wonderful team, ever since. 

I’ve mastered all kinds of services— styling curly and textured hair, color correction, perms, hair extensions, formal up-dos, barber cuts and Brazilian Blowouts.
